Lot 1837    

1918, 3¢ violet Offset, type III, Earliest Known Usage. Large margin single in combination with 2¢ Engraved (#499) on corner card cover to Canton, China, tied by "New York, N.Y., Apr 6, 1918" machine postmark, "Shanghai, May 8, 18" transit and receiving backstamps, two green Officially Seal, Chinese Post Office labels tied by Canton postmarks; light cover wear and slight crease in 2¢, F.-V.F., with this being the Earliest Known Usage of any U.S. Offset Lithograph definitive, the printing method was introduced as an austerity measure following United States entry into the First World War, an important cover of the Washington-Franklin period.
Scott No. 529    Estimate $1,000 - 1,500.

Realized: $1,250

Lot 1838    

1923, 1¢ green, rotary sheet waste. Tied by "Plymouth, N.H., Dec 21, 1923" cds and duplex killer on Christmas post card to Boston, Mass., Fine, an attractive example of the 1923 1¢ Rotary Perf. 11 issue on cover, a great rarity; with 2006 A.P.S. certificate.
Scott No. 544    $7,500.

Realized: $4,000
